Christina Milian BiographyChristina Milian, a twenty something Cuban product is on its way of replacing the widely exaggerated obssesion with Cuban cigars.This Libran was born to Cuban-native parents in New Jersey and raised in Waldorf, Maryland.She was born tio become an actress. From the very childhood, it appeared as if she simply prospered to become a starlet that she is today.Her acting career got triggered at a very tender age ,with her role as Annie Warbucks in the theatrical musical version of Annie. And even before the young girl could reach her teens, Milian had doled out as a junior journalist on the Disney Channel's Movie Surfers.Soon after this she bagged a number of guest roles on television.In 1998 Christina, the juvenile actress voiced characters in the popular animated feature A Bug's Life. With ensuing roles in American Pie and The Wood, Milian found herself gaining face in front of the camera, and with 2001, she hosted the popular television series Wannabe.This appearance of Christina was almost immediately followed by the release of her self-titled solo debut album.Her teaming up with rapper Ja Rule for the breakthrough hit "Between Me and You" exploded her musical career and her charisma on the big screen gained impetus. With exposure of this kind , recognistion and applauds are bound to come, and similar happened with Christna as well.In next to no time ,she was joining forces with none other than Jennifer Lopez to pen the hit single "Play". Next in line Milian began working upon the production of her second full-length album .The infectious single "AM To PM" which hit the top position on Billboard's Hot 100 Singles chart in 2001, was just a taste of what this multi-faceted young female is proficient of. All of a sudden, Christina was a huge star at destinations .She was glad to know that her music was enjoyed by those who did'nt even knew english."I'd grown up watching people like Michael and Janet Jackson. People who were universal superstars, so for me, being able to conquer different territories was a very big deal. The whole experience made me more confident and proud that I could reach so many people. Sure it was hard not having an album available back home but in the end it all worked out for the best. I had the chance to tour (she hit 17 countries between 2001-2002) and work on my songwriting. So everything happens for a reason and I know I'm blessed." Now, she could be seen on the big screen in some of the high-profile releases as Love Don't Cost a Thing (2003) and Torque (2004). Creative ChristinaVery few people would be aware about this facet of the actress.She is well trained at designing and making clothes, and she admits "I make a lot of my clothes. My mom and I tend to go to thrift stores. We'll get tons of shirts and jeans. We'll cut it all up and dye pieces of the jeans. Then we'll piece it all together to make dope jeans and skirts and stuff.I don't like wearing the same thing everybody else wears" |
